Handover: Marisol → Teodor, for the support team's reference. The static-analysis baseline file for the Copperfen scanner lives in the config repo under the baselines folder; never edit it by hand, always regenerate via the refresh script. If regeneration fails with a checksum error, the encrypted seed archive must be restored first. Support can perform that restore themselves; the archive unlocks with the recovery phrase below.

unlock words, yaguf-fajep: praiel-kasdor-druax-wenix-fenok-juldor-eliox-zordor-novath-quenir

Handover note — Crumbwheel order cutoffs.

Welcome aboard. The bakery cutoff rule in Crumbwheel closes same-day orders at 14:00 local to each storefront, not UTC — this has bitten us twice. Holiday overrides live in the calendar service and take precedence silently, so always check there first when a cutoff looks wrong. To unlock the calendar service's admin console after a restart, enter the recovery passphrase below.

vault phrase of bagap-bahaf = silion-pelox-sorox-casdor-quenwyn-fraax-eliox-praael-kelion-quenvan-kasox-rusael-norius-belvan

The key difference between them is websocket compression. Per-message deflate saves roughly 60% bandwidth on chatty clients but costs CPU and adds latency under burst load, so production enables it only for slow-link tiers, while staging mirrors production and dev leaves it off entirely for easier packet inspection. Support staff triaging "slow connection" reports should first confirm which environment and compression tier the customer is on. The staging environment currently runs with these settings:

deployment values, yadug-bawif:
[framir]
team = pelox
access_code = ac_a38ab2
owner = tamion.julael
host = framir.tolvaqlabs.test
port = 11211
peer = tammir.zemvargrid.local
salt = 2215ef03
pin = 1541

- [ ] **Step 7: Breaker override escrow.** After sealing the signing keys for the Tallgrove upstream API circuit breaker, confirm the support team can force the breaker open during a full outage. The override bundle lives in the sealed escrow drawer and is useless without its unlock phrase. Two ceremony witnesses must initial this step before proceeding. The escrow bundle is decrypted with the recovery passphrase that follows.

vault phrase of kahip-kahop = holath-quenmir